Join us for a powerful monthly community series focused on understanding trauma, strengthening emotional wellness, and building healthier connections. Hosted at Providence Athletic Club, this four-part series creates space for meaningful learning and open conversation in an environment centered on growth, resilience, and whole-person wellness.
Beginning in April and continuing on the second Friday of each month, this series explores how trauma influences our thoughts, relationships, behaviors, and overall well-being.
Our first session introduces the foundations of trauma—what it is, how it affects individuals and communities, and how it can shape the way we move through the world. Future sessions will explore the impact of trauma within families, intimate relationships, and gender dynamics.
Each event will include approximately 75 minutes of guided teaching followed by 45 minutes of facilitated community dialogue. Participants will leave with new insights, practical understanding, and the opportunity to connect with others in a supportive space.
Whether you are interested in personal growth, community healing, or learning more about trauma-informed living, this series offers an opportunity to reflect, connect, and grow together.
